This question shoudl not be asked under normal circumstances, as if the camera mount matches the lens mount, ALL such lenses should work fine. In the case of his tiny camera, however, the smaller/lighter the lens you use, the better off you are.

Keep in mind, however, that the A-cam dll has a 2/3-inch sized sensor and not a Super 16mm film frame size sensor. In other words, its sensor is SMALLER than the S16 film frame is. This means that when you add a lens to this camera, you are losing focal length, namely, your ulra wide angle short focal lens will become a regular wide angle lens. So, for insrtance, your 6mm wide angle may become an 8mm wide angle, you are losing quite a bit of your angle of view with it.

Since this csmera has a 2/3-inch sensor, you would need to match it with a 2/3-inch (B4) ENG lens or cine-style manual B4-mounted lens. Unfortunately, B4 is not one of the mounts that this camera can be equipped with.

Let's get your terminology correct. No lens loses focal length from one camera to another. The sensor size gives the same lens a different angle of view for a given focal length.
